Job Summary:
The Residential Support Worker at Phoenix Society is a member of the integrated services team. In line with the overall purpose of facilitating the capacity building of participants to maximize their community reintegration and supporting residents who are transitioning out of Federal Correctional Institutions, the Residential Support Worker is accountable for: client supervision and monitoring, assessing public risk and client needs, client support, community building with Corrections Service Canada, local police and other external partnerships.
Responsibilities:
Client Services
-
Support the clients in adhering to the community guidelines set out in both their CSC conditions and Program Agreement conditions
-
Support clients with their community reintegration plans by maintaining accurate logging and documentation as required by the Society and Corrections Service Canada.
-
Build a therapeutic relationship to support the client in their life skills and goals
-
Support proper reporting/documentation and collaboration for: breach of conditions which include but are not limited to: suspected alcohol or drug use; clients who late for curfew and/or do not return home; escalating, unsafe behaviour; emergency medical situations; client requests to go to the hospital; and power failures, fire, or other emergency conditions which require staff supervision or consultation
-
Respond to emergencies within a moments notice, via rapid response to all areas of the CRF building, as per established protocols
-
Once trained through CSC and Management/Case Managers at Rising Sun, Male- identifying staff must support Urinary Analysis requirement such as scheduling appointment with client, ensuring client follows established protocols, labelling and signing, and arranges pick up with specified receivers
-
Delivering food to residents of Rising Sun and to push food cart around the various CRF floors
-
House walks for 3-6 times per shift on all the floors of the CRF, ensuring safety and presence of residents
-
As directed, provides medication assistance to residents, including meeting residents at designated off-property locations (up to 100 meters), in accordance with organizational policies, safety procedures, and applicable legislation
